为什么用VPN上不了Twitter?常见原因与解决方案详解
作为一名网络工程师,我经常遇到用户反馈:“我用了VPN,但还是上不了Twitter(推特)!”这个问题看似简单,实则涉及多个技术层面的复杂因素,今天我们就从网络原理、安全策略、以及实际应用角度,深入分析为何使用VPN后仍无法访问Twitter,并提供切实可行的解决方案。
我们要明确一个基本事实:并非所有VPN都能稳定访问Twitter,很多用户使用的“免费”或“廉价”VPN服务在性能、带宽和服务器稳定性方面存在明显短板,这类服务可能只提供单一节点,甚至被目标网站识别为高风险流量源,从而直接封禁,这是最常见的原因之一。
Twitter对异常访问行为极为敏感,它会通过多种方式检测并阻断非正常连接,包括但不限于:IP地址黑名单、设备指纹识别、DNS污染检测等,即便你使用的是知名付费VPN,如果该服务的IP段已被Twitter标记为“可疑”,也会导致访问失败,比如某些地区(如中国大陆)的公网IP,因历史问题被Twitter列入“高风险区域”,即使使用了加密隧道,也难以绕过其风控系统。
DNS解析问题不容忽视,有些VPN客户端默认使用本地DNS解析,而未启用“DNS over HTTPS”(DoH)或“DNS over TLS”(DoT)功能,这可能导致你的请求被中间人劫持或篡改,在国内某些网络环境下,即使你成功连接到境外服务器,DNS仍可能将你导向错误的IP地址,从而出现“连接超时”或“无法访问”的提示。
防火墙策略(尤其是国家层面的网络监管)也在起作用,像中国这样的国家,对境外社交平台实施多层次过滤,包括IP封锁、端口限制(如443端口被干扰)、以及深度包检测(DPI),即便你使用了强加密的OpenVPN或WireGuard协议,只要数据包特征被识别,仍可能被拦截,这时候,仅靠更换服务器位置是不够的,必须结合协议优化和隧道伪装技术。
那么如何解决呢?建议如下:
- 使用经过验证的商业级VPN服务(如ExpressVPN、NordVPN),它们有大量全球节点且持续更新IP白名单;
- 启用“Kill Switch”功能防止DNS泄露;
- 优先选择支持“Obfuscated Mode”(混淆模式)的协议,如Shadowsocks或WireGuard + obfs4;
- 检查是否启用了正确的DNS设置,推荐手动配置为Cloudflare(1.1.1.1)或Google DNS(8.8.8.8);
- 如果以上无效,尝试切换不同地区的服务器,避开已知黑名单IP段。
能否用VPN访问Twitter,不只是“有没有连上”的问题,而是整个网络链路是否干净、隐蔽、合规的问题,作为网络工程师,我建议用户理性看待工具的作用——真正的解决方案在于理解底层机制,而非盲目依赖某一款软件。




